Turnovers in basketball occur when a team loses possession of the ball to the opposing team. This can happen through various means such as bad passes, traveling violations, or offensive fouls. Turnovers can have a significant impact on the game as they give the opposing team an opportunity to score and can disrupt a team's offensive rhythm. Teams that commit fewer turnovers generally have a better chance of winning as they have more opportunities to score and limit their opponents' scoring chances.
